The Dynamics of Right-Wing Protest : : A Political Analysis of Social Credit in Quebec / / Michael B. Stein.

This study combines in one volume a history and sociopolitical analysis of the group now called the Ralliement des Créditistes, and thus explores the dynamics of a contemporary social and political phenomenon – right-wing protest.
